I have 6 baby quails that hatched 1 day ago. I took them out of the incubator 4 hours ago and put them in the brooder. They didn't seem to eat at all so I put the crumbles on my hand and put it in front of them. After an hour or so I saw them eat maybe a grain or two but then again nothing. Also, I tried reaching 95 degF in the brooder but I could only reach 90 degF. The quails seem to do fine with it. Not really limiting to one part of the brooder so I guess it is fine?
Another thing, once I hand-held them, they are only sleeping in my hand now. Not sure why or if it is ok? They seem healthy. They just look more comfortable in my hands than when in the brooder. And they have just been sleeping my hand for the past hour.

So, overall, I am worried about two things. One is that they don't seem to eat much presently, and another is that they only sleep comfortably in my hand now.

Your chicks may not eat much during their first 24 hours. They are still absorbing the yolk from their egg, so it's okay. If they have eaten some, then they know how, so I wouldn't worry about them.

90 in the brooder seems cold for newly hatched chicks, but as long as they're not piling onto each other trying to get warm, then they're okay.
